Captain & Chef or Stew Crew Couple 

Captain  &  Stew or Chef Crew Couple

Yacht: Brand New Yacht – Launching July 2026

Start Date: Captain: May 2026

Contract: Seafarers 12 month contract with medical cover included.

Flag: Malta

Salary: Captain: €7,000 per month –  Depending on Experience / Chef: €5,000 p/m DOE / Stew €3,500 p/m DOE

Location/Programme: The yacht is taking part in the Cannes & Monaco boat shows in September 2026, before heading to Sardinia for a photo shoot and some owner use. The yacht will then sail to the Caribbean and will take part in the Antigua Charter Show in December 2026, ahead of her Caribbean charter season.  The yacht will charter dual seasons in the Mediterranean & Caribbean.

Owners: German owners, English speaking, three children aged 19, 17 & 16. The owners plan to come aboard for 5/6 weeks per year.

Crew Requirements: The crew will ideally have previous experience providing high-end standards onboard a yacht of a similar size and specifications, with a proven ability to uphold exceptional standards at all times.  Candidates should excel in creating bespoke, luxury charter experiences, demonstrating meticulous attention to detail and an intuitive approach to guest service.  The four person crew must work seamlessly as a close knit team, supporting one and another across all areas of the yacht as required.  An exceptionally high standard of cleanliness, organisation, and pride in the vessel’s presentation is essential at all times.

Captain: RYA Yachtmaster Offshore (Ocean) with commercial endorsement (minimum), ENG1, STCW (or personal survival & first aid) or equivalents, GMDSS Radio License.  The Captain should have minimum of two years previous private or charter experience in command of similar size vessel and experience servicing and maintaining onboard systems inc; engine, air conditioning, water maker, generator.

Excellent crew leadership skills, strong guest facing skills, confidence in voyage planning, weather routing and safety management.

Chef: STCW, ENG1, Food & Hygiene Level 2.  Candidates must demonstrate the ability to consistently produce high end, beautifully presented three course meals to a luxury charter standard.  Equally important is the ability to adapt menus to each guest preference sheet.  Candidates should be organised, clean, and efficient in a yacht galley environment.  They should also be adaptable and resourceful, with proven experience provisioning in different countries and working creatively with locally available produce when specific ingredients are not always accessible.

Stew: STCW, ENG1, Food & Hygiene Level 2.  We are seeking a highly organised and detail driven stew to manage the interior to an exceptional standard.  They need to help with provisioning if required, catering & assisting on deck if needed. Previous barista experience and mixology experience is essential, along with silver service skills and an eye for table decor.  Also required to be open to take direction from others, with a friendly approach and strong team player attitude.
